The journey of GPS tracking technology began in the 1970s when the U.S. Department of Defense launched the first satellite-based navigation system. Initially designed for military use, it wasn’t long before the civilian sector recognized its potential. By the late 1990s, GPS devices started finding their way into consumer markets, allowing everyday adventurers to harness the power of satellite navigation. Fast forward to today, and GPS technology has not only improved but has become integral to outdoor adventures.

The latest advancements in GPS tracking are nothing short of spectacular, offering features that enhance both navigation and peace of mind. Today’s devices are more than just locators; they are equipped with state-of-the-art technology that allows for real-time tracking, two-way communication, and even SOS functionalities. Consider the Garmin inReach Mini, a compact satellite communicator that allows you to send and receive messages, even in remote areas where cell service is nonexistent. This device not only helps you stay connected but can also alert rescue teams in emergencies, showcasing how technology can truly revolutionize your adventures.

So, what are some of the key challenges adventurers face, and how can innovative GPS technology offer solutions?
- Challenge: Getting Lost - When the trail disappears or your map fails, fear can set in. The right GPS tracking device can help you find your way back without panic.
- Solution: Reliable Navigation - Brands like Garmin and Suunto offer devices that not only track your location but also provide real-time updates on your route, ensuring you stay on course.
- Challenge: Limited Battery Life - Many outdoor activities can drain your device's battery, leaving you vulnerable.
- Solution: Power Management - Newer models come equipped with power-efficient modes and solar charging options, allowing you to keep your device running longer.
- Challenge: Natural Obstacles - Dense forests and mountainous terrains can interfere with GPS signals.
- Solution: Advanced GPS Technology - Devices featuring dual-frequency GPS, such as those from inReach, allow for more reliable tracking in challenging environments.
